We prepared ofloxacin restricted access media molecularly imprinted polymers using surface‐initiated atom transfer radical polymerization on the surface of brominated silica gel using ofloxacin as a template molecule, methacrylic acid as a functional monomer, and ethylene glycol dimethacrylate as a crosslinking agent.
